			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>How brave is Robb Wolf?  Well, the author of the best-selling book, the <a title="The Paleo Solution" href="http://www.amazon.com/Paleo-Solution-Original-Human-Diet/dp/0982565844" target="_blank">Paleo Solution: the Original Human Diet</a>, is brave enough to let me twist his character into that of a lovable serial killer. While developing the script for a marketing video I&#8217;m producing for his gym, Norcal Strength &amp; Conditioning, it occurred to me that a mash-up between the Paleo lifestyle and the open to the hit show, Dexter, would be fun. Robb agreed and here&#8217;s the result. I shot all of the scenes with a Canon 5D mark II and the versatile Canon EF 100mm/2.8 macro USM lens.Most of the scenes are close to the actual open but I had to make small modifications to make it Paleo-Kosher; like coconut butter instead of regular and running shoes instead of boots. Thanks to Robb for being such a great sport and sharing my warped sense of humor!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Over the past few years, I&#8217;ve had the pleasure of working with a good friend of mine, Chuck Lundgren of <a title="Iris Software" href="http://www.iris-software.com/index.htm" target="_blank">Iris Software</a>, on the <a title="FRWA Website" href="http://www.freeportproject.org/index.php" target="_blank">Freeport Regional Water Authority project</a>.  As the end of the contract approached he asked me to create a 3D animation of the intake facility and adjoining pipeline segments.  Always glad to tackle a 3D challenge, I modeled and rendered the intake facility and the several twists and turns of  miles of pipeline that connects the Sacramento river to the Folsom South Canal .</p>
<p>The model of the building was provided to me in a CAD file which needed several days of &#8220;fixing&#8221; to make everything render correctly. I built everything else from scratch basing much of the layout on a simple Google satellite map. I used Lightwave 9.6 for both the modeling and rendering. Of course, there was the occasional trip to After Effects for integration with some of the 2D mapping elements.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>As if <a title="Adobe CAF" href="http://tv.adobe.com/watch/photoshop-20th-anniversary/contentaware-fill-sneak-peek/">Content Aware fill</a> wasn&#8217;t enough, Adobe has unveiled a significant upgrade to their lens  correction technology. Now included in Lightroom 3 and Camera RAW 6.1  (shipping with the CS5 Suite), is the ability to easily correct lens  distortion, chromatic aberration, and vignetting. Now some of these  controls have been available in earlier versions, but not in a one-click  tool that also provides a great deal of manual overrides and the  inclusion of both preset and custom profiles.</p>
